Kentucky State Police investigating officer-involved shooting in Kenton County
KSP said the investigation remains ongoing after an officer-involved shooting that left a Crestview Hills man dead.
Kentucky State Police are investigating an officer-involved shooting in Kenton County that left a man dead, according to a statement from KSP issued Monday, June 21.
KSP said the victim was a Crestview Hills man. The agency did not immediately provide additional identifying details in the initial report.
The shooting prompted an investigation by Kentucky State Police, which said the inquiry is ongoing. Investigators have not, in the initial public information, released the circumstances leading to the encounter or the specific location in Kenton County beyond the county itself.
KSP said it continues to work to determine what occurred before, during, and after the shooting, and that additional updates would be provided as the investigation progresses.
